I69.36
I69.36 —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ction
Non-billable headerICD-10-CM
I69.36 is a non-billable header ICD-10-CM code for other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ction. It cannot be billed on its own: choose one of the more specific child codes below.

Risk adjustment
I69.36 does not map to an HCC and does not risk-adjust under CMS-HCC V28. That is normal — most ICD-10 codes do not. It still needs to be coded correctly; it just will not move a RAF score.
Code to one of these instead I69.36
6 child codes. Green means billable.
- I69.361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ction affecting right dominant side
- I69.362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ction affecting left dominant side
- I69.363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ction affecting right non-dominant side
- I69.364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ction affecting left non-dominant side
- I69.365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ction, bilateral
- I69.369Other paralytic syndrome following cerebral infarction affecting unspecified side
